Ermelo’s Felicia Desmore saddles up horse and rides for Christ

“The Lord will bless you through the love you have for horses.”

Ms Felicia Desmore, an equestrian in Ermelo, had her first horse riding experience with a professional at just six months of age and has since never looked back.

When she was younger an elderly woman, Ms Eunice van der Merwe approached her and said: “You will ride with Christ every time you get on a horse’s back.”

“The Lord will bless you through the love you have for horses.”

Ms Desmore said she believed what Ms van der Merwe told her and from that day on she began her equestrian journey and riding for Christ.

She has since competed in the Mpumalanga SANESA (South African National Equestrian Schools Association) Championship in 2012 and the South African Boerperd Champs in 2019.

One of her highlights was when she joined the South African ‘Calela Boerperd Stoet’ in 2017.

“This year is when my horse won Horse of the show.

“I am very proud to say that I am part of the Calela Team.”
